Tyson Fury has responded after being called out by Oleksandr Usyk following the Ukrainian's victory over Daniel Dubois.

Usyk, 38, produced yet another boxing masterclass as he stole the show inside Wembley Stadium, London, against Dubois, 27.

The Ukrainian was a class above and unleashed a powerful left hook in the fifth round to send Dubois onto the canvas.

Dubois was visibly stunned and failed to beat the count as the referee waved to signal the end of the bout.

As a result, Usyk is now an undefeated, three-time undisputed heavyweight world champion.

Speaking immediately after the fight, Usyk called out Fury and three other fighters, he said: "Nothing is next. It's enough, next, I don't know. I want to rest. My family, my wife, my children, I want to rest now. Two or three months, I want to just rest.

"Maybe it's Tyson Fury. Maybe we have three choices, Derek Chisora and Anthony Joshua. Maybe Joseph Parker. Listen, I cannot now say because I want to go back home."

Taking to social media, Fury congratulated Usyk and then claimed that he won their previous two bouts and vowed to do it all again.

He said in a video: "Massive shout out to Oleksandr Usyk. He did a fantastic job performance tonight over Daniel Dubois.

"They came for a good tear up. So, congratulations to both men. But, Oleksandr Usyk knows there is only one man who can beat him. I did it twice before and the world knows it. I have been f*****."

Fury continued: "I took it like a man. Here is me... not f****** around at some boxing match. I am out on the road running. I am running tonight. I came home. I did my job and I got myself back.

"I am the man. I am the f****** spartan. And no matter what anyone wants to say, I f****** won them fights. Guaranteed. 100 per cent. There is only one man! Get up!" You can watch the video below. Warning: The video contains strong language.

Fury wrote in the caption: "@usykaa congratulations, there’s only one man who can beat you again and that’s a Gypsy K Tyson Fury done it twice regardless of what the politics say!"

Reacting in the comments section, one fan said: "You lost twice pip down. Joseph Parker is definitely next in line. Beat AJ and Someone from top 5 then you deserve a shot again."
